### Hardware Key Extraction
To use this bridge on Linux (Docker), you need a **hardware key** extracted from a real Mac. This key contains hardware identifiers needed for iMessage registration.

The key is entered interactively through the bridge bot's login flow (not configured via Ansible variables). See the upstream [README](https://github.com/jasonlaguidice/imessage/blob/main/README.md) for instructions on extracting the key.
If extracted from an Intel Mac, the Mac does not need to remain running after the key is extracted for this bridge to work. Apple Silicon Macs must run a NAC relay.
